What is your favorite book of all time?
The Stars my Destination by Alfred Bester. It's a crazy book, a little politically dated now because it was written in the 50's, but it's a science fiction revenge story that is amazing. I love the escalation of the action and the consequences of the protagonist's choices -- there's nothing that you can predict, and it's mindblowing as it happens. The ending stuns you.

What was your inspiration to write your book?
My inspiration to write GILT came from the history itself.  I’d been reading about Henry’s wives for a while, wanting to know more about the women of the era.  Catherine Howard was his only wife who was a teenager when he married her.  I wanted to write for teens.  It seemed like a good fit.
But as I learned more about Catherine, as I read the accounts of her actions, I was inspired to do more.  She is often portrayed as a dumb blonde, or an innocent corrupted.  Even historians label her ignorant, flighty, promiscuous.  People make much of the tragic love affair with Thomas Culpepper.  I wanted to find a different angle.  Portray Culpepper’s history as I really see it.  And give Catherine the voice of a worldly manipulator.  A Queen Bee long before she became Queen.
